Since 1880, U.S. Social Security records show 16,014 babies named Hollis, peaking in 1921. See the year-by-year trend, decade totals, and state rankings below, sourced from federal birth data.

Hollis's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Divide Hollis's SSA record in two at 1953 and the more recent half accounts for 42%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 58%, a genuinely balanced usage pattern. Its calmest year was 1881,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 1921 peak of 294,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.

Hollis by state
Where Hollis concentrates geographically, total births since 1880
| Rank | State | Visual share | Births | Share of total |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| #1 | Texas | | 1,905 | 11.9% |
| #2 | Alabama | | 1,049 | 6.6% |
| #3 | Georgia | | 1,021 | 6.4% |
| #4 | Tennessee | | 972 | 6.1% |
| #5 | Mississippi | | 741 | 4.6% |
| #6 | Louisiana | | 635 | 4.0% |
| #7 | Arkansas | | 419 | 2.6% |
| #8 | California | | 335 | 2.1% |
1,905 of 16,014 births nationwide. Compared to a flat distribution across 37 reporting states.
